Where does a Maglev run? On a guidance track with magnets/ Above a guide way on a magnetic field. Where does a steel wheel train run? On a steel rail When running,how much does a Maglev float? About 10mm above the guide way
10
What pulls a Maglev forward? And how? The guideway itself, by changing magnetic fields. What pulls a steel train forward? An onboard engine.
11
How does a Maglev work? 1.Floating on a magnetic field. 2.Pulled by the guide way itself by changing magnetic fields.
12
Advantages 1. Easy in keeping.2. Having no friction. 3. Having less noise. 4. High speed. 5. Speeding up quickly. 6.climbing slopes easily. 两车交汇视频 磁悬浮视频
13
Disadvantages 1.more expensive 2.lack of existing infrastructure. 课间休息音乐
